hu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L多主复制的实现与应用|mysql 主从复制,MySQL多主复制

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文介绍了Linux操作系统下MySQL多主复制的实现与应用。通过对传统的MySQL主从复制,详细阐述了多主复制的概念、配置方法及其在实际应用中的优势,为数据库的高可用性和负载均衡提供了新的解决方案。

本文目录导读:

  1. MySQL多主复制的概念
  2. MySQL多主复制的实现方式
  3. MySQL多主复制的应用

随着互联网技术的飞速发展,数据库系统在高可用性、数据一致性和故障转移方面提出了越来越高的要求,MySQL作为一款流行的开源关系型数据库管理系统,提供了多种复制策略以满足不同场景的需求,本文将详细介绍MySQL多主复制的概念、实现方式以及在实践中的应用。

MySQL多主复制的概念

MySQL多主复制是指在一个复制集群中,多个MySQL服务器相互作为主服务器进行数据复制的过程,在这种复制模式下,任何一台服务器都可以接收客户端的写操作,并将这些写操作同步到其他服务器,与传统的单主复制相比,多主复制具有以下优势:

1、提高数据可用性:当一台服务器发生故障时,其他服务器可以继续提供服务,确保数据的持续可用性。

2、提高写入性能:多台服务器并行处理写操作,可以显著提高写入性能。

3、实现负载均衡:通过多主复制,可以将写操作分散到多台服务器上,降低单台服务器的负载。

MySQL多主复制的实现方式

1、开启binlog日志:在所有参与复制的MySQL服务器上,开启binlog日志功能,用于记录数据的变更。

2、配置服务器参数:在my.cnf配置文件中,设置以下参数:

- server-id:为每台服务器设置一个唯一的标识符。

- replicate-do-db:指定需要复制的数据库。

- replicate-ignore-db:指定不需要复制的数据库。

- binlog-format:设置binlog日志的格式,推荐使用ROW格式。

3、配置主从复制关系:在每台服务器上,配置主从复制关系,具体操作如下:

- 在主服务器上,创建一个用于复制的用户,并授权该用户具有REPLICATION SLAVE权限。

- 在从服务器上,配置主服务器的IP地址、端口以及复制用户的密码。

4、启动复制线程:在从服务器上,执行START SLAVE命令,启动复制线程。

MySQL多主复制的应用

1、高可用性:在多主复制环境中,当一台服务器发生故障时,其他服务器可以继续提供服务,确保数据的持续可用性,可以通过添加新的服务器来扩展复制集群,进一步提高系统的可用性。

2、数据备份:通过多主复制,可以将数据同步到多台服务器上,实现数据的备份,在发生数据丢失或损坏时,可以从备份服务器中恢复数据。

3、负载均衡:将写操作分散到多台服务器上,可以降低单台服务器的负载,提高系统的并发处理能力。

4、故障转移:在多主复制环境中,当一台服务器发生故障时,可以快速将故障转移至其他服务器,确保业务的持续运行。

MySQL多主复制是一种有效的数据复制策略,可以提高系统的可用性、备份和负载均衡,在实际应用中,根据业务需求和场景,合理配置和优化多主复制环境,可以充分发挥其优势,为用户提供更加稳定、高效的数据库服务。

相关关键词:MySQL, 多主复制, 数据库, 复制策略, 高可用性, 数据备份, 负载均衡, 故障转移, binlog日志, 主从复制, 配置参数, 服务器, 启动复制, 高效数据库, 业务需求, 系统优化, 数据同步, 故障恢复, 数据损坏, 数据丢失, 备份服务器, 并发处理, 稳定服务, 开源数据库, MySQL集群, 数据库复制, 复制环境, 数据安全, 数据迁移, 数据库扩展, 数据库维护, 数据库管理, 复制用户, 授权权限, 数据库配置, 复制线程, 数据库故障, 数据库恢复, 数据库性能, 数据库监控, 数据库备份策略, 数据库优化, 数据库扩展性, 数据库集群, 数据库可靠性, 数据库高可用, 数据库负载均衡, 数据库故障转移, 数据库故障恢复.

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

MySQL多主复制:mysql三种复制模式

原文链接:,转发请注明来源!